Use the optional series connection set (

ER-VWAR80

) for series connection (One 

set per unit is required). The maximum No. of the connectable units is 5 (Including 

this unit). When using the units in series connection, fit the end connector on the 

connector for series connection of the unit connected to the end. Even if only one 

unit is used, fit the end connector on the connector for series connection.   

Fit the air inlet fitting (enclosed with the series connection set) after taking the sealing 

cap off with a hexagonal wrench. The tightening torque should be 0.5N

m or less. 

Note that the gasket is fit in the air inlet. Be sure to tighten the fitting with the gasket.  

When using the units in series connection, make sure that the air pressure around 

the air inlet of each unit is appropriate.

Take care that when using the products in series connection, the applied air pressuredrops 

gradually unit by unit. (The volume of the drop depends on the connected tube length.)

The air monitor function is to monitor the supplied air pressure. If the air pressure falls less 

than 0.02MPa approx., the discharge from the needle stops and the indicator lights up. If 

the air pressure rises again after the pressure fall was detected, discharge starts again.  

The air monitor function always check the air pressure and independent from the other functions 

(ERROR, CHECK or the discharge halt input). Thus, even in the state that the discharge was 

stopped by another function, if the air pressure falls, the air monitor indicator (orange) lights up. 

In the state that the discharge from the needle stops, such as when the air pressure fall is detected 

or while the discharge halt input is input etc., CHECK and ERROR detection function do not operate. 

The discharge halt input is invalid in error state. CHECK function doesn't operate as well.

When the discharge from the needle stops due to the air monitor function, the discharge 

halt input or ERROR detection function, the detection result by CHECK function is erased. 

The detection is carried out again when the discharge from the needle restarts.

Remove the cause of error, and then reset the unit. In case the cause of error has not been 

removed, the unit goes into the error state again. 

In order to reset the unit in error state, turn the power off and on again. 

In case the discharge from the needle is controlled in the state that air is supplied, CHECK 

may be output temporarily due to a transitional state of the discharge phenomenon. 

However, the charge removal capability remains the same.

MAINTENANCE

11

If dirt, such as dust, etc., is stuck on and around the discharge needle or inside 

the nozzle depending on the environment of use, the charge removal effect  

deteriorates. Clean those areas periodically, as a reference, once a week.

However, when using this product in the environment exposed to too much dust, 

be sure to clean up the discharge needle frequently.

The discharge needle is a part having a product life time. It is recommended that 

the needle should be replaced, as a reference, after 10,000 hours in use. When 

the needle is replaced, replace the discharge needle unit (optional).

Make sure to turn off the applying air and the power supply while inspection, 

cleaning or maintenance is carried out. 

Before loosening the nozzles for maintenance etc., be sure to stop applying air. 

Otherwise, the discharge needle unit may be flew by the air pressure.

WARNING

Procedure for cleaning and replacing the discharge needle nit


Unscrew the discharge needle counterclockwise.

Remove dirt on and around the discharge needle, inside the 

nozzle and inside the tube fit in the nozzle with a cotton bud 

soaked in absolute alcohol. Particularly, clean inside the tube 

fit inside the nozzle and around the discharge needle 

thoroughly such that any dirt or grease doesn't remain there 

(refer to the right figure), or the charge removal capability 

may deteriorate. Remove / fit the discharge needle along the 

guide groove on the air outlet of the main body. 

After cleaning, screw the nozzle clockwise. Tighten the 

nozzle by hand till it stops and then confirm that the nozzle 

doesn't move. If the nozzle is not tightened enough, the 

charge removal capability may deteriorate or the nozzle may 

come off.
